USB ext HD not found on AEBS

750 gb OWS SATA HD in an OWS powered enclosure w/ USB 2.0. HD is formatted Extended (Journaled). Loads to desktop on both iMac and MacBook but does not show up when connected directly or thru an unpowered USB hub to the AEBS (1st Gen N). An 80 gb portable HD in an unpowered Iomega enclosure works w/ no problems when connected to the AEBS. I have tried connecting via the Go menu under Finder and the Apple Disk Utility to no avail. I am pretty sure that the OWC HD originally would connect to the AEBS w/ the OWC original enclosure but it failed. Any ideas?

Most users need to use a powered USB hub with a hard drive at the USB port of the AirPort Extreme.....even if the hard drive has its own power supply.
The Macs have high power USB ports. The Extreme does not.
Give this a try if you have not already done so.

  • I can no longer print using wifi. I have to connect a USB cable to print. Setup and pref show that I should be able to print wireless but I keep getting printer not found msg when trying.

    I can no longer print via wifi. I could at one time but now I have to connect to printer with USB. All settings appear correct in printer and macbook. Sys pref shows printer with green light next to idle. Sending a print prompt results in "searching for printer, printer not found, ensure printer is turned on". I have reinstalled printer in my print list and reinstalled printer software on macbook. Kodak 5250 AiO printer shows it's configured for and on wifi channel. I go online with laptop using wireless but cannot print. Help!

    If you know the IP address of the printer, then you can check if there is a working path between the Mac and printer. This can be done using Network Utility or a web browser.
    If you open Network Utility and select the Ping tab, you can enter the IP address of the Kodak and then press the Ping button. If there is a working connection then you should get a reply to each packet sent.
    With the web browser, many devices have a built-in web server so you can type the IP address of the printer into the browser and if there is a working connection then you will open the printers web page.
    So, are you able to confirm you have a working connection between the Mac and printer?

  • I am considering purchasing a new Mac desktop. I have, at present, a Liteon 851S ext CD/DVD write and a Maxtor 3200 USB ext hard drive. Will these work with a Mac desktop? My local Apple store could not answer my question.Happy New year to all.

    I am considering purchasing a new Mac desktop. I have, at present, a Liteon 851S ext CD/DVD write and a Maxtor 3200 USB ext hard drive. Will these work with a Mac desktop? My local Apple store could not answer my question.Happy New year to all.

    Yes the Mac can read that drive but you would need to Copy the data off of it to the Mac as apposed to Move, which implies Deleting them from the drive as they were transferred from the external to the Mac. Since the Mac can Not Write to NTFS drives it can't Delete anything as that is really a Write operation, IE Making changes to the NTFS formatted drive.
    Once you have that Data on Both your New Mac and you Older Windows PC you can format that drive to work on both system.
    If you want to and plan on doing that post back and I'll explane how, it is simple but should be done on a Windows PC.
    If you only plan on using it on the Mac from now on that is fairly simple also and is done on the Mac, Once you have the files from it stored on the Mac.

  • External USB Storage not found Lenovo IX2

    Hello,
    When I try to connect my 4TB External USB Drive to my ix2 it does not get gound. I also tried a friends 3TB Drive which does not work. When I connect a smaller 500gig drive it does get found.
    It looks like large external USB drives are not accepted. Is there a solution for this?
    Thanks,
    Rigel

    Hi rigelpaulin,
    This device cannot read external drives over 2TB. You will have to limit the partitions on the drive to 2TB or less.
